Understanding the Nicaraguan Dating Landscape

Cultural Foundations Matter

Nicaragua’s rich heritage blends indigenous traditions with Spanish influence. Family ties are strong, and many women grow up in close‑knit households where respect and loyalty are prized. Knowing these values helps you frame conversations in a way that feels natural and sincere.

  • Family First – Expect conversations about family gatherings, Sunday lunches, and celebrations of “fiestas patronales.”
  • Community Spirit – Many Nicaraguan women are active in local churches or community groups. Mentioning shared community interests can spark instant rapport.
  • Language Nuance – While many speak English, a few phrases in Spanish— like “¿Cómo estás?” or “Me encantaría conocerte mejor”— show genuine interest.

Crafting a Profile That Resonates

Photo Tips for Authentic Appeal

Your photos are the first impression. For Nicaraguan women, authenticity shines:

  • Show Your Lifestyle – Include a picture of you enjoying a local festival, cooking, or exploring nature.
  • Smile Naturally – Warm smiles convey the friendliness valued in Nicaraguan culture.
  • Avoid Over‑Editing – Clear, natural lighting works best.

Writing a Bio That Speaks Their Heart

Keep your bio concise (2‑3 short paragraphs) and highlight shared values:

“I love family gatherings, especially Sunday meals with arroz con pollo. I’m learning Spanish because I want to understand the stories behind each tradition. Looking for a partner who enjoys music, community events, and building a future together.”

Notice the blend of personal detail, cultural nod, and relationship intent. This approach invites replies that feel personal rather than generic.

Messaging Strategies That Build Chemistry

First Message: Make It Personal, Not Generic

Instead of “Hey, how are you?” try a line that references her profile:

“I saw you love the Fiesta de Santo Domingo in Managua. I’ve always wanted to experience the fireworks and traditional dances. What’s your favorite part of the celebration?”

This shows you’ve read her profile and share a genuine curiosity.

The 3‑Step Conversation Blueprint

  1. Connect – Ask open‑ended questions about her interests.
  2. Share – Offer a short, relatable story from your own life.
  3. Invite – Suggest a low‑pressure activity, like a video call to exchange recipes.

Using this structure keeps the dialogue balanced and forward‑moving.

Overcoming Common Pitfalls

Mistake #1: Ignoring Language Barriers

Even if you speak Spanish, using slang or overly complex phrases can cause confusion. Stick to clear, simple language until you gauge her comfort level.

Mistake #2: Rushing the Relationship

Patience is a virtue. Many Nicaraguan women prefer a gradual build‑up, especially if they have strong family ties. Show respect for her pace.

Mistake #3: Over‑Sharing Personal Details Too Soon

Keep early conversations light. Discuss hobbies, favorite foods, and travel dreams before diving into deep personal history.
